The comparator helps compare two analog input signals.
Purpose
Two comparators are available:
If differential value (A - B) between input A and B:
Function principle
–
Is greater than "Limit value on", the comparator turns on.
–
Is smaller than "Limit value off", the comparator turns off.
A should (normally) be greater than B, as the difference (A – B) is evaluated with
preceding sign, and the limit values cannot be set negative.
Note
A - B
On
Min. switch-on and switch-off times can be set for the output signal of the
comparator along with a switch-on and switch-off delay.
These adjustable times are always active (except during wiring tests).
8.2.1
Activate comparator
Assign an input to activate the comparator.

Time format
h:m, m:s
m:s
You can select format "Hours:Minutes" as an extended time format (> 59.59 m.s)
for the comparator.
Important: The changeover impacts all time-related parameters of the
comparator (switch-on/off delay and min. switch-on/off time).
Notes
Time format "h:m" offers a 10-minute increment setting range.
